NURA 303: Oxygenation, Perfusion, and Respiratory
Assessment Key Concepts
Key Respiratory Terms and Definitions
Definitions of Key Terms
Anoxia: The absence or almost complete absence of oxygen
from inspired gases, arterial blood, or tissues.
Apnea: Absence of spontaneous breathing, which can lead
to hypoxia if prolonged.
Bradypnea: A decrease in respiratory rate, often indicative
of underlying health issues.
Cheyne-Stokes Respirations: A pattern of deep fast
breathing alternating with slow shallow respirations, often
seen in patients nearing death.
Dyspnea: Difficulty breathing, which can be a symptom of
various respiratory conditions.
Eupnea: Normal adult breathing rate of 12–20 breaths/min,
indicating effective ventilation.
Additional Respiratory Terms
Expiration: A passive process of breathing out, essential for
removing carbon dioxide from the body.
Hyperventilation: Overbreathing often caused by anxiety,
leading to decreased CO₂ levels in the blood.
, Hypoxemia: Insufficient oxygen in the blood, which can
lead to tissue hypoxia if severe.
Hypoxia: A condition where SpO₂ is less than 90%,
indicating inadequate oxygen supply at the tissue level.
Inspiration: An active process of breathing in, crucial for
gas exchange.
Kussmaul Respirations: Deep, slow, or rapid breathing
often associated with metabolic acidosis, such as in diabetic
ketoacidosis.
Ventilation vs. Perfusion
Definitions and Importance
Ventilation: Refers to the movement of air in and out of the
lungs, essential for gas exchange.
Perfusion: The circulation of blood through the pulmonary
capillaries, where gas exchange occurs.
Effective oxygenation requires both adequate ventilation
and perfusion; a deficiency in either can lead to respiratory
failure.
Conditions such as pulmonary embolism can impair
perfusion, while asthma can affect ventilation.
Understanding the balance between these two processes is
critical in managing respiratory conditions.
Clinical assessments often involve measuring both
ventilation and perfusion to diagnose respiratory issues.
